Point-of-Sale Data and Omnishopper Solutions
Within NielsenIQ’s UK retail measurement, Omnishopper Solutions integrate Point-of-Sale Data from physical stores with digital transaction feeds to map the full purchase path. The process follows a clear sequence: first, Point-of-Sale Data captures in-store item-level sales, prices, and volume across retailers. Second, Omnishopper Solutions overlay e-commerce and click-and-collect transactions to identify cross-channel switching. Finally, the combined dataset reveals which omnichannel touchpoints drive conversion and how basket composition shifts between online and offline orders for the same shopper.

Comparing Pricing Models: Project-Based vs Retainer
When comparing pricing models, project-based fees suit defined, one-off studies where you want a fixed cost and clear deliverables, while retainers offer better value for ongoing tracking and ad-hoc queries. Project-based vs retainer decisions hinge on your research cadence; if you need quarterly brand health checks or continuous customer feedback, a retainer secures lower per-project rates and priority access. Q: Which model saves more money for a single market audit? A project-based quote, as you avoid paying for unused retainer hours.
Hidden Costs in Data Collection and Reporting
When evaluating the best market research companies UK, clients must scrutinise hidden data processing fees often buried in data collection and reporting. These can include charges for data cleaning, coding open-ended responses, or weighting samples to https://tritonmarketingresearch.com correct demographic imbalances. Reporting may incur extra costs for bespoke dashboards, advanced analytics, or iterative chart revisions. Unforeseen expenses also arise from raw data access, fielding soft launches, or handling low-incidence populations requiring targeted re-contact. Clear service-level agreements should itemise every step from questionnaire programming to final data visualisation, preventing budget overruns tied to assumed inclusions.

Ethical Data Collection and GDPR Compliance
In the context of the UK’s best market research companies, ethical data collection is now a competitive differentiator, directly tied to GDPR compliance. These firms prioritize explicit consent, ensuring participants understand exactly how their data will be used before collection begins. They implement robust data minimization practices, gathering only what is strictly necessary for the specific research objective, not for vague future analysis. Furthermore, data is pseudonymized or anonymized at the point of capture, and respondents are given clear, simple mechanisms to withdraw consent or request deletion. This proactive approach builds trust and yields higher-quality, more reliable insights.
